Product overview
The MX-4200 is a cutting-edge device, fundamentally consisting of an advanced radar array, a precision-engineered mechanical turntable, and a reliable power adapter. This innovative system excels in the detection, monitoring, and target indication of micro to small civilian drones in sensitive zones like borders, perimeters, and airports. It delivers pinpoint trajectory data, including critical details such as target orientation, distance, altitude, and speed, ensuring comprehensive situational awareness.
